About Breather

Breather creates and curates a network of beautiful, on-demand private spaces that you can reserve and unlock via our web and mobile apps. We are live in 10 cities across 3 countries and backed by some of the best investors in NYC and Silicon Valley. We enable top companies to do more productive and inspired work and are growing quickly! We're venture-backed; we have big ambitions, and we want you to help us achieve them.

What to expect

Breather’s engineering and product is organized in small, autonomous, self-directed teams that are empowered to solve their customers’ needs. You will be part of the InfoSys team, whose mission is to develop the internal systems used by our employees. Breather’s software is deeply enmeshed in the physical world and we strive to build systems that make our logistics, support and sales operations smoother and more efficient. As a senior backend engineer on that team, your key responsibilities will be to build develop the business logic through data models, services and REST apis. 

Our stack includes:

  • Node.js
  • MongoDB
  • RabbitMQ
  • ElasticSearch
  • Redis
  • AWS

In this role, you will:

  • Build: In collaboration with your cross-functional team, you will design, build and iterate on new features that solve your customers’ problems and make them happy. You will architect backend systems that are fast, scalable and reliable, and design apis that are enjoyable to use.
  • Code: At Breather, we want great developers who love and care about the craft of computer programming. You will write clean, tested, and maintainable code.
  • Lead: You will help your teammates grow through example, code reviews, and mentoring.
  • Plan: You will elaborate the roadmap with your teammates. As part of the backend functional team, you will help drive the long-term direction of our systems’ architecture.

About You:

You are highly motivated and enjoy programming and building things. You know how to make backend services fast, scalable, maintainable, and enjoyable to use. You care about the craft of writing clean code.  You see beauty in HTTP headers and JSON output. You have a solid understanding of networking, distributed systems, and UNIX. Ideally, you will also have experience with systems-level programming, Docker, and DevOps.

In addition to experience with some of the technologies we use, you have the following:

  • A bachelor’s degree in Computer Science/Engineering, or equivalent
  • 5 or more years in an engineering or development role
  • Excellent communication and interpersonal skills
  • The need to keep your skillset current; a thirst for knowledge

Bonus Points:

  • Links to live, on-the-web examples of your work (Github, Stack Overflow, etc.)
  • You're familiar with our product and have some ideas on things you'd want to add or change

What We Value

At Breather, our company values are not only the principles that link us together in the way we work, but they also keep us aligned on the same path, all working towards connected goals. These standards are what guide us on our collective journey through space(s).

Perks and Benefits

We hope that you're excited by all the possibilities that come with working at Breather! In addition to our unique culture, we also offer these fun perks and benefits:

  • Be part of a well-funded, proven startup with big ambitions, competitive salary and company equity
  • Work when you want, where you want, with the tools you want
  • Company-funded travel to conferences & professional development events that interest you and benefit your career growth
  • Access to comprehensive medical, vision, and dental coverage. Oh, and it’s on us
  • Free access to the Breather network of over 400 spaces (and growing, fast!)
  • Dog-friendly office - bring your dog to work, they’ll find plenty of friends waiting to play with them!

Apply for this Job
* Required
Almost there! Review your information then click 'Submit Application' to apply.

File   X
File   X

Share this job: